Abstract

The nearest neighbor interpolation,the bilinear interpolation,and the bicubic interpolation,all are commonly used interpolation algorithms,with the add of Matlab,the paper realizes the three interpolations.It shows in experiment that,there are better continuity and high simulation for topography.
